Omaggio is the Italian word for homage or tribute, and as we consider the subject matter of the three solo concerti, this is undoubtedly the thread between them. In chronological order, Peter Graham’s In League with Extra-ordinary Gentleman is dedicated to three euphonium playing family members, with literary stars titled in each of the three movements. Philip Harper’s evocative and dramatic concerto is a tribute to the great grandfather of Micah Parsons, the young euphonium player who commissioned the work from the composer. Henry Nichols was killed in the First World War and the events surrounding this tragic event provide the subject matter for this concerto. Philip Sparke’s Euphonium Concerto No. 4 with subtitle Omaggio is written as a tribute to our soloist’s father, Rex Mead who passed away in January 2021. Rex was a kind, loving father and husband, who sporting prowess, good nature and true gentlemanly conduct inspired all those he came in contact with.

Three shorter contrasting works provide balance to these wonderful concerti. Lucy Pankhurst’s colourful work receives its premiere recording as does Luc Vertommen’s superb arrangement of Piazzolla’s masterful Cafe 1930. Ken Downie’s setting of The Sally Gardens provides a suitable benediction to the action, drama and high emotion of the main works of this album.

Review from Thomas Dunne, Brass Band World, Oct.2019

In this new release Swiss euphonium player, Fabian Bloch, breaks new ground with an outstanding selection of no less than eight première recordings of new repertoire in a ‘jazz trio’ style.

He opens with François Killian’s Bogalusa. The cheeky syncopated rhythms, and nonchalant piano and drum kit accompaniment paint a delightfully nostalgic picture of the small Louisiana town famous for its jazz and blues. Composed by Bloch’s former euphonium colleague at Fairey Band, Jim Fieldhouse’s Vault reveals a sonorous tone in the expansive opening passages, followed by showcasing a considerable technical ability. Meanwhile, Blazing by Fabian Kunzli proves to be a fascinating, often mesmerising work, ranging from dance passages to mysterious moments of introversion.

Daniel Schnyder’s ATLAS concerto features as the major work of the disc. Inspired by the snowy mountain peaks of Marrakesh, the listener is transported to North Africa with driving, richly ornamented lines. The second movement creates an almost Indian atmosphere in its improvisatory feel and impressive range. The third evokes South America with its lively, dancing jazzy rhythms and features a notable extended cadenza.

The Latin America vibe continues with Ncore by Roland Szentpali. As this rousing, hip-swaying encore progresses, the listener almost forgets that the performer is playing euphonium and becomes absorbed in the perfectly captured style. Famous for his challenging euphonium concerto, Jukka Linkola’s new Euphonia is an extended two-movement work of epic proportions, contrasting energised funky passages and broad melody. Next, Daniel Hall offers a characteristically fascinating work, Wheeap!, inspired by jungle drum, bass and reggae delivered in a performance of pure energy! This continues in Andy Scott’s From This Earth, which explores the themes of courage and determination in a minimalist, yet spirited work. For an encore, Fabian Bloch switches to bass trumpet in a cheeky rendition of Daniel Schnyder’s 2005 work Karachi, which transports the listener to the Arabian Sea in a cascade of technical flourish.

Fabian Bloch has indisputably proved the potential of the euphonium in the ‘jazz trio’ setting through an outstanding level of performance and repertoire, which fuses traditional forms with a plethora of styles. Combined with excellent recording and understated, yet informative presentation, this innovative disc will have a lasting appeal for audiences, including those far beyond the brass band sphere.

Fabian Bloch, a Swiss musician, has shown since his childhood an unconditional passion for the euphonium, an instrument he studied at the Berne University of the Arts, in the class of Thomas Rüedi, before continuing his improvement at the Royal Northern College of Music in Manchester (United Kingdom), where he obtained a Master in Performance under the tuition of Steven Mead. At that time, he also played for “Fairey Band”, an world famous brass band, and performed at numerous concerts and competitions throughout England.

As a soloist, Fabian Bloch is constantly looking for new challenges, both in Switzerland and abroad. His first solo-CD, “Drive”, was released in September 2015 and was literally praised by the specialised press. His strong interest in new music is also reflected in the “Spot On!” project of his trio, in which he presents lots of new compositions.

Fabian Bloch currently plays with the european Brass Ensemble and in various leading brass bands in Switzerland and Great Britain. He also regularly gives concerts with his duo Euphorimba (euphonium and marimba).

He also passes on his passion to the next generation of euphonium players as an teacher in two music schools and teaches students of all ages in his own studio, “Brass Sounds”.

He completes his wide range of activities with frequent engagements as an extra in the Basel Symphony Orchestra, the Zurich Opera Orchestra, the Lucerne Symphony Orchestra and the Berne Symphony Orchestra.

A Review by Iwan Fox, 4Barsrest.com

Eleven years after he last linked up with conductor Luc Vertommen and Brass Band Buizingen, Steven Mead returned to the recording studio in 2016 for this thoughtful release.
 
Lyricism in brass playing is in danger of becoming an eroded art: The pursuit of ever more audacious technical brilliance has made it an increasingly difficult musical language to understand as well as master.

Polyglot

However, both elements can still be combined, and here the soloist states his case for appreciation with a cultured sense of authority. Mead is one of the last true polyglots.

The ten tracks are a series of mature performances of eclectic inspiration - from the bullish Iberian swagger of Bandman’s ‘La Corrida de Toros’ to the poetic resignation of Mahler’s ‘Ich bin der welt abhanden gekommen’.  In between we touch on elements of reflection as well as celebration, lasting delicacy to bluesy ephemera.

Expertly realised

The virtuosity on display is skilled and artistic; the lyricism imaginative and beautiful (essential characteristics he himself identifies in his perceptive sleeve notes). The performances are enhanced by equally considered accompaniment (including the use of a harp) and subtly coloured arrangements, expertly realised by Luc Vertommen.

Same coin

The centre-pieces are balanced counterpoints: Golland’s darkly hued ‘Concerto’ is a work of personal complexities hidden in plain view; layers of seeming transparency that still obscure a central core of troubled emotions.  In contrast, Proto’s fantasy on the famous ‘24th Caprice’ by Paganini lays all bare - sumptuous, rich, extrovert.  

They are still two sides of the same musical coin though. And it is a currency that Steven Mead shows throughout is still worth its weight in gold.

The band was founded in 1879 as a fanfare band by workers of the local porcelain factory.  In 1975 it was amongst the first Belgian bands to convert to the traditional British-style brass band instrumentation.  Since then, the band has played a leading role in the Belgian band world, gaining prizes at competitions and recognition for its musical approach both at home and abroad.  Over the years it has given notable concerts and contest performances, released numerous CDs and, in 1997, had the particular honour conferred on it of being named ‘Cultural Ambassador of Flanders’. 

More recently, BBU won the Belgian National Championships three times, in 2009, 2012 and 2015 and represented Belgium at the European Championships in Stavanger, Linz, Oslo and Lille.  In 2011 BBU was runner-up at the World Music Contest in Kerkrade and in 2012 the band was runner-up at the All England Masters.  Brassband Buizingen won the Flemish Open Brass Band Championships VOBK) three times.  The band was honoured by SABAM (the Belgian Society of Authors, Composers and Publishers) with the prestigious Fugue-Trophy for their contribution to Flemish band music and received the title of Cultural Ambassador of their hometown, Halle which is based in the South of Brussels.

 

Brassband Buizingen had the honour to play in concert with Steven Mead several times and record the highly acclaimed Euphonium Virtuoso CD in 2005 with Steven Mead and team up with him again 11 years later for his latest solo album.  You can find more information on their website http://www.brassbandbuizingen.be.

 

Conductor Luc Vertommen

 Dr. Luc Vertommen was born in Leest (Mechelen) where he made his first acquaintance with wind music through the local fanfare band.  He studied cornet, music theory and piano at the music academies in Mechelen and Willebroek.  Further musical studies were completed with a triple diploma in trumpet, music history and band conducting at the Lemmensinstitute in Louvain.  He also obtained a first prize in chamber music at the Royal Conservatory in Brussels, a master degree for conducting and Doctor of Musical Arts (2011) at Salford University, Manchester, (UK).  He has immersed himself full-time in the world of band music as a brass teacher, player, conductor, arranger and writer. 

He conducts Brass Band Buizingen (Belgium), Brass Band Nord-pas de Calais (France) and is head of music school in Deurne (Antwerp).

He can be heard on more than 25 highly acclaimed CD recordings and is editor and artistic director of Band Press VOF.  He regularly is invited to conduct or adjudicate around Europe and obtained the International Buma Brass Award 2014 for his international work within the band movement.

His interest for the past and for band history started a series of books and CD recordings.  For this Anthology of Flemish Band Music, he received the Fugue-Trophy by Sabam (the Belgian authors right association) in 2011.  He unearthed many pages and hours of original music by Belgian composers and his interest for the future is shown in his collaboration with many contemporary composers.

As an arranger some of his arrangements (especially those made for fanfare band and brass band) are played worldwide.

The story behind Hosanna

 A chance meeting with the wonderful Polish organist Lidia Książkiewicz in France some nine months ago awakened my curiosity of how it would be to record an album with euphonium and organ. I have made many recordings over the years, variously with brass band, piano, brass quintet, brass ensembles and multitrack for example, and with each of these the outcomes were all quite predictable, and in many cases the repertoire quite bountiful.

 In my head I could imagine the rich sound of the euphonium set against the resonant sound of a cathedral organ, two mighty voices playing in harmony!

 I set about looking for suitable repertoire and spent a few weeks searching music libraries and online resources. It immediately became clear that there was almost no original literature for this combination and not put off by this,  I sought out a balance of other works for brass and organ, classical arrangements and songs that might create not only a musical balance, but would allow a chance to show off the potential of this combination. During a very brief visit to the Strasbourg Conservatory where Lidia is also a professional piano accompanist, we took the occasion to try out some of the repertoire. We recognised instantly that this combination had so much potential. The CD project therefore became inevitable.

The logistics were quite quickly worked out and Lidia made enquiries whether we could use Laon Cathedral for the recording. Lidia is the resident organist there knew the full potential of this great organ. As we discussed the repertoire we also were discussing some Baroque works and perhaps using a second organ that was more suitable for this music. About 25 km from Laon is the town of Guignicourt and the organ there was absolutely suitable for a couple of pieces from all that. All the other pieces of jigsaw felt together relatively easily in place.

Steven Mead has for some years visited Italy regularly, bringing his instrument to this country of music lovers who, it must be said, seem to have fallen in love with the sound of the euphonium. Thanks to his numerous visits to Italy (including Aosta, Milan, Trento, Bolzano, Bologna, Florence, Rome, Ancona, Bari, Calabria and Sicily), he has developed a musical affinity with the country, the people and their music. This unique CD is another landmark in the relationship between Mead and this country and for the growth of the popularity of the euphonium in Italy.

 

It has always been part of the Italian band music tradition to play pieces from the operatic repertoire using instruments, especially those of the saxhorn family, to "imitate" the human voice. This tradition began in the nineteenth century when, given the lack of radio and records, the band was the medium of broadcasting the fashionable melodies of operatic music in the town squares. Today Italian bands are following many different musical paths, including the current extensive repertoire of original pieces. Dedicating almost an entire CD to operatic Romances and Arias therefore has a double meaning: on the one hand it pays homage to this genre, whose intrinsic beauty defies description and on the other hand it does that which virtuosi and instrumental soloists all over the world have always done, that is to give a ‘voice' to these immortal works through their instruments. It's easy to forget that whilst Monzil Brass can delight you with their theatrics and humour in concerts performances, what you are actually listening to is a group of highly accomplished professional musicians playing at a level few other brass ensembles can match.

Lasting impression

The fun and games are great of course, but it's the playing that invariably leaves the more lasting impression on the mind.

That's not to say that even the aural experience can be a touch surreal at times too: especially with this, their latest highly inventive release.

Almrausch is a form of musical journey (although named after the Alpine Rose flower, seen on the CD cover) - obliquely a Wayfarer's memory trip from the nursery slopes of Mount Blanc to the local Mnozil pub, via the peaks and villages of the French, Swiss and Austrian Alps.

Staggering

On their way the intrepid travellers rest their weary limbs by enjoying themselves playing arrangements of local folk songs, marches and waltzes, plus the occasional bit of musical whimsy in a style that somehow encompasses staggering ensemble playing with almost ‘Jeau san Frontier' silliness.

Almost that is.

Authentic

The mental image is of lederhosen and funny felt hats, red faced Austrian farmers and busty serving wenches in local watering holes - yet at the same time the music is beautifully naive, rendered with an authentic bucolic sense of the folk tradition of the region.

The 27 individual tracks melt into each other like Spring time snow - some lasting as little as 5 seconds in duration, yet moving the musical journey forward by yet another significant step.

Hikers

Stop offs come in the form of jaunty marches interwoven with playful waltzes, melancholic folk tunes, sturdy polkas, dances and odd ball diversions, the players taking turns to lead from the front like co-operative hikers.

The surreal sense of adventure is brought home at its conclusion - a breathless arrival at the door of the local pub is followed by a ruinous celebration and morning after hangover, which takes the form of a bleak, but grateful paean to composer Alban Berg.

Reflective

In between we get all those mental images chucked into the Mnozil blender - from reflective musical panoramas to an almost 1970's 'Cinzano' advert inspired waltz, that starts somewhere in a mountain pass village and ends downtown in a jazz club in New Orleans.

Expect the unexpected with Mnozil and you will be left delighted with this authentically original release. Expect to try and understand the raison d'etre behind what they do - and you will be left wondering what on earth you have let yourself in for.

Brass Band World review January 2010:

 

"Any new Steven Mead CD excites high expectations and this latest doesn’t disappoint.

Drawing heavily on classical repertoire with a little help from the arranging skills of Luc Vertommen, the transcriptions are thoughtfully interspersed and there are several original pieces from the pens of Goff Richards and Peter Graham, amongst others.  The choice of music places as much emphasis on the lyrical qualities of the instrument as it does on the stunning virtuosity of the soloist – all to compelling effect.

It’s not simply  the technique that impresses, however.  In the case of Tchaikovsky’s Variations on a Rococo Theme and Saint-Saens’ Allegro Appassionato, both mainstays of the cello repertoire, it is Steven Mead’s stylistic affinity with the music that it marks the playing out as truly special, whilst in Roger Derongé’s Walking on Music and Goff Richards’ Pilatus, the control and phrasing of the lyrical lines is a joy to behold.

For pyrotechnics, though, Bizet’s Carmen Fantasy steals the show with playing from the soloist that, at times, almost beggars belief.

Although the acoustic is a touch and brittle, Andy Duncan and Whitburn band provide carefully judged accompaniment.

To quote the title of the David Gillingham piece, performed with such elegance, Steven Mead proves again that his is artistry and musicianship of a rare ‘vintage’.  It all makes for a disc not to be missed.

Thanks to Luc Vertommen for the inspiration behind this remarkable CD. The music of Jules Demersseman is certainly unknown to brass players at present. But this recording of his 'lost' works for the now extinct six valve trombone, a creation of the instrument maker Adolphe Sax in the early 19th century, is sure to put his music into the minds of brass players now. It is wonderfully inventive and spontaneous music which tests the ability of even today's players. How these virtuoso pieces were played on the trombone with 6 independent valves we just don't know, it seems too remarkable for words!! Enjoy this latest CD recording by Steven Mead and the brilliant accompanist Tomoko Sawano.

Jules (Auguste Edouard) Demersseman (1833-1866) was in his time a remarkable flautist and meritorious composer. Historically the most important works he composed were those for the new trombone with six independent valves developed by Adolphe Sax.

The works that Demersseman wrote for this new instrument could be easily subdivided into two main categories : the typical exam-pieces (Volume 1) and the themes and variations usually based on well known operatical themes (Volume 2). Both the typical ‘Solo de Concert' (the exam-pieces used at the Paris Conservatory) and the themes and variations breathe the Parisian musical taste of that era and the influence of romantism and salon music. They focus on the many technical difficulties and virtuoso effects a student should master and the emotional expression. This new and first complete edition for euphonium and piano was mainly based on the original 1865 editions published by Adolphe Sax himself and are suited perfectly for the modern day euphonium players.
